Transaction 20a4023c14329c737f44f929999d088d251fd4ffc96ec5a1d97eab856c856bb8
1 Input
1 Output
-
20a4023c14329c737f44f929999d088d251fd4ffc96ec5a1d97eab856c856bb8:0
- value
- 447610582
- script pubkey
- OP_0 OP_PUSHBYTES_20 70dc4ff997e0a61d85a7b96c6079a340b7c27db4
- address
- bc1qwrwyl7vhuznpmpd8h9kxq7drgzmuyld5emwnh6